Dignam Surname Meaning
Irish: from Gaelic Ó Duibhgeannáin see Dignan.
English: of uncertain origin. Reaney and Wilson suggests this is a habitational name for someone from Dagenham formerly in Essex now in Greater London.
This gets its name from an Old English personal name Dæcca + genitive -n + hām ‘homestead’ but this is implausible.
Source: Dictionary of American Family Names 2nd edition, 2022
